Hoping someone can help me answer a question. I have my AXIA 1Gig overclocked to 133. Everything seems to run well and my temps are below 50 at all times but every once in a great while, my system will lock up. The only thing I can think of is my power supply because temps are only around 45C when the lockups occur. My 5V value from my PW on the other hand, is at 5V 95% of the time. 5.03 the other 10%. It is a 300W AMD certified PS, but I'm wondering if the low 5V value could be locking up my system. Do I need more juice?

no 300 watts is usually enough. If you have multiple hard drives or something else that takes a lot of juice you might need a bigger power supply, but it sounds to me like that processor just cant run stable at 1333 Mhz. So maybe tone it back a little and it will run stable. Are you running your voltage to the max, and what hsf are you using?

To maintain the performance of your 1Gig@1333 when you drop it down a bit try upping the fsb. It sounds strange but I had a TB 750 that would only run at 100x10.5=1050. No higher on the multiplier, but when I dropped the multi. down to 8 I ran the FSB to 138=1104 and it ran like a champ. Sometimes raising your FSB will give you more performance increases then the multiplyer.
